Output 88b4923b148a94ca3f7e5f4329f679192c70abdc57930b8003a3ea250a6769e8:0

value
299330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8a7c3c2a3e3d76caefd3f35b8e616923627354 OP_EQUAL
address
3HhC5Evj4ePXeGe3XhWemAy16qqY5QwmpU
transaction
88b4923b148a94ca3f7e5f4329f679192c70abdc57930b8003a3ea250a6769e8
spent
true